In this episode of Beastly Talks, we're diving into a somewhat complicated topic to wrap your head around: how punishment can open the door to reinforcement. For a lot of dogs – especially dogs with a low stress tolerance – panic quickly sets in and shuts off any form of positive reinforcement opportunity. The dog gets stuck in what I call a "Mindset trap", where stress begets more stress, resulting in high levels of anxiety and zero interest in external reinforcement. Many trainers talk about "keeping the dog under threshold", but very few explain how to bring the dog back down when it's over threshold. Introducing considered pressure and even punishment, can be the prediction error the dog needs, to recommence the training. Complicated topic, but hopefully I've been able to make it understandable!
